Produktbeschreibung
The date was Friday, February 15th, 2915, when Womankind's first faster-than-light starship, S.E.A.S.S. StarChild, left the Matriarchate on its very first mission into deep space far beyond Womankind's own home system.Originally intended to be a mission of peaceful exploration and scientific research, it developed instead into one of violent conflict, a battle for survival between those resourceful and courageous women aboard StarChild and an insidious alien menace as ancient as it was beyond insane-alien beings that threatened not only StarChild's crew but the whole of Humanity.It's a story related here in great detail, not only from the viewpoint of those intrepid women who lived it, but the loved ones they left behind as well in those last few days leading up to StarChild's early departure.It's a story of not only survival but also love and romance, loyalty and devotion in dangerous and uncertain times, and told here for the very first time.It's a story of that herstory-making beginning of Womankind's future exploration and colonization of deep space beyond the Tammyite Matriarchate, the many worlds of Womankind.
